在 SquareSpace 中插入可缩放矢量图形 (SVG) 图标

已发表: 2022-12-10

如果您想在 SquareSpace 中使用可缩放矢量图形 (SVG) 图标,则需要了解一些事项。 首先,您需要找到或创建一个 SVG 图标。 获得图标后,您可以使用以下代码将其插入 SquareSpace 页面或博客文章: 将“icon.svg”替换为您的 SVG 图标文件的名称和位置。 “alt”属性是可选的,但推荐使用; 它为屏幕阅读器和其他无法显示图像的设备提供图标的文本描述。 将 SVG 图标插入页面后,您可以使用 CSS 对其进行样式设置。 例如,您可以更改其颜色、大小或在页面上的位置。 要了解有关在 SquareSpace 中使用 SVG 图标的更多信息,请访问其支持站点。

SVG 文件是小文件的理想选择,因为它们基于可缩放矢量图形 (SVG)。 在 SVG 示例中,我们可以创建 1,000 或 100 像素宽的文件,质量和文件大小相同。 我们必须先将 sva 文件上传到 Squarespace。 这是您可以将自定义图标添加到页面内容的方法。 如果你想让你的图标在块上居中,你可以使用这个代码片段。 现在您的设计中有了一些 SVG 图标,您应该能够更有效地使用它们。 您可以立即获得 20 分钟的免费咨询。

在 Squarespace 仪表板中,转到“设计”>“自定义 CSS”; 在底部,单击“管理自定义贡献”按钮,这将允许您上传您的图标图像。

这个问题是由于svg 文件(包括 XML 代码)链接到外部源(CDN),并且浏览器阻止 svg 作为安全措施引起的。 如果无法添加 *,最简单的解决方案是想办法这样做。 此方法可用于防止 CDN 使用 HTML 访问 SVG 文件。

我可以在 Squarespace 上使用 Svg 标志吗?

我可以在 Squarespace 上使用 Svg 标志吗?
照片由 – websitesetup

虽然 Squarespace 目前不支持SVG 标志,但您仍然可以使用带有一些 CSS 的标志来替换主标志。

为什么你应该使用 Svg 作为你网站的标志

sva 不仅仅是徽标。 SVG 可用于各种插图和图标。 如果您购买库存插图,您应该寻找矢量/eps 版本,因为这是每次购买时都包含的内容。 需要帮助创建徽标的矢量、 SVG 版本以及网站的更新外观吗? 因为它是基于矢量的,所以它不会遇到与基于位图的徽标相同的问题,使其成为创建徽标的绝佳选择。 此外,SVG 文件体积更小,加载速度更快,因此非常适合网站。 如果您正在寻找几乎可以在任何规模的网站上使用的徽标,那么您来对地方了。


如何嵌入 Svg 图标?

如何嵌入 Svg 图标?
摄影:克劳德

您可以通过几种不同的方式在网站上嵌入 SVG 图标。 一种方法是使用 HTML 元素。 这是最常用的方法,所有浏览器都支持。 另一种方法是使用 CSS 背景图像属性。 并非所有浏览器都支持此方法,但如果您需要支持较旧的浏览器,则可以使用。 最后,您可以使用 JavaScript 库 Snap.svg 来创建您自己的自定义 SVG 图标。 此方法更复杂,但为您提供了最大的灵活性。

另一方面,内联 SVG 图标允许我们为同一图标选择不同的颜色。 当您使用 Svg-sprite 时,您可以在您的网页中包含一个 SVG 符号文件。 在服务器上,您可以将 SVG 文件嵌入到 index.html 文件中。 简单的 CSS 文件调整将导致耗时较少的图标位置。 我们正在使用 service worker 测试内联 SVG 图标加载。 当 sw.js checksum 发生变化时,service worker 安装会自动恢复; 但是,这种方法不同于服务工作者的 JavaScript 文件。 当我们在 sprite 文件前面使用 CDN 时,唯一的版本号允许我们稍后在使用 Service Workers 时使用它。 更改后,我们将更新此博文。

如何在 Html 文档中嵌入 Svg 图标

在 HTML 文档中嵌入sva 图标的最佳方法是什么? 要在 HTML 文档中嵌入 SVG 图标,请使用 VS 代码或您喜欢的 IDE,复制代码并将其粘贴到 HTML 文档中的 body> 元素中。

Svg 文件可以用作图标吗?

Svg 文件可以用作图标吗?
摄影 – clipsafari

因为它们是矢量图形,所以它们可以用作您网站上的图标,这是一件好事。 矢量图形可以缩放到任意大小而不会降低其质量。 由于文件很小且压缩得很好,因此您的网站加载速度不会太慢。

它是一种矢量图像格式,可以使用可扩展标记语言 (XML) 语法绘制。 XML 代码块(例如 SVG)通过使用其 XML 代码块格式直接呈现到浏览器中并通过浏览器呈现。 与文字相比,这些图像可以更快地显示动作和信息。 大约在 Tamagotchis、iMac 和 Palm Pilots 成为家喻户晓的名字的同时,SVG 图像文件被引入网络。 因此,大多数网络浏览器不支持SVG 格式。 当 Web 浏览器在 2017 年首次开始渲染 SVG 时,没有出现任何问题。 如果您选择使用 SVG 或图标网络字体,由于它们的矢量,您将不会遇到缩放问题。

由于可用选项的数量,预制图标集受到更多限制。 如果您想为您的设计添加更多功能,您应该考虑使用 .sva 文件。 创建 SVG 图标有两种方法:手动或使用工具。 通过使用矢量图像程序,您可以在虚拟绘图板上绘制图标。 如果导出您的 .svg 文件,您就完成了。 此外,Evernote 列表包含一组随时可用的免费 SVG 图标。 在定义形状的尺寸时,x 和 y 是唯一定义形状与其尺寸之间的空间的元素。 类名也可以在单独的样式表 CSS 文件中指定,其中包含 >svg> 或 >rect 元素的类名。 通过更改背景颜色,可以直接在 Ycode 无代码生成器中更改这些图标的颜色。

这是一个变量,可以包含任何其他文本或 XML 内容以及 HTML 文件。 因此,它可用于生成和显示文档中的文本和 XML 内容。 请参阅以下有关使用 *image 的指南 在文档中使用 image> 元素是包含光栅图像文件的最佳方式。 svg width=”200 ” height=”200 图片src=image.jpg width=200 height=200. svg 可以在菜单中找到。 您应该包含一个 *image> 元素以包含额外的文本或 XML。 Weebly的width=200,height=200,font style=width=200都列出来了。 您也可以输入“图片”。如果您没有看到,我是您的公司。 Text xml:space-preserve 我们公司经营时间长,服务优良。 您正在阅读的文本未显示。 如果您使用的是图片,请单击此处。 可以在您的文档中找到 svg 文件。您可以使用 *image= 元素在文档中包含徽标或其他图形。 Thesvg width is 200 and thesvg height is 200. *image src=images.png 可以上传svg文件。 使用 *image> 元素以导航或其他方式包含图像。 HTML:宽度:200,高度:200,宽度:200 图片 src=imagesrc=hover.png width=200 height=200。 *nav>nav>nav *li.*.img src=div.png 宽度=200 高度=200。 */li> */nav 用作导航系统。

Png 和 Svg 图标的优缺点

如果按正确的顺序缩放 SVG 图标,则可以在不损失质量的情况下缩放它。 它们也作为 Adob​​e Creative Suite 的一部分在 Web 浏览器中可用,并且可以使用任何矢量图形编辑器进行编辑。 另一种选择是在支持该文件格式的浏览器中使用PNG 图标。 最终决定使用 PNG 还是 SVG 图标的是浏览器兼容性。 如果您不需要 Internet Explorer 8 或更早版本,则可以改用 .sva 图像。 如果您仍然需要使用这些浏览器,则可以改用 PNG 图标。

将 Svg 上传到 Squarespace

将 Svg 上传到 Squarespace
摄影 – 方形空间

没有将 SVG 上传到 Squarespace 的内置方法,但可以使用一些变通方法。 一种方法是将 SVG 文件保存到您的计算机,然后将其作为常规图像文件上传到 Squarespace。 另一种方法是使用 CloudConvert 等第三方服务将 SVG 文件转换为另一种格式(如 PNG 或 JPG),然后将转换后的文件上传到 Squarespace。

Squarespace 自定义图标

这个问题没有一个明确的答案,因为它可能取决于使用 Squarespace 的个人或组织的具体需求和偏好。 但是,一般来说,自定义图标可以为 Squarespace 站点添加独特而专业的风格,并可以帮助访问者快速轻松地找到他们正在寻找的信息。 如果您有兴趣将自定义图标添加到您的 Squarespace 站点,可以在线找到许多教程和资源。

将图标添加到您的 Squarespace 网站是为您的设计增添视觉趣味的好方法。 它可以通过多种方式完成,每种方式都有自己的优点和缺点。 某些图标可能需要订阅,而其他图标可能会受到保护以防止未经授权的使用或限制。

Squarespace 将图标添加到文本

将图标添加到您的文本是为您的 Squarespace 网站添加视觉趣味的好方法。 有几种不同的方法可以做到这一点,具体取决于您要使用的图标类型。
如果您正在寻找一种快速简便的方法来将图标添加到您的文本中,您可以使用 Squarespace 的内置图标库。 为此,只需单击工具栏中的“I”图标,然后选择您要使用的图标。
如果你想更好地控制你使用的图标,你可以使用 HTML 实体。 例如,要添加心形图标,您可以使用代码“”。
最后,如果您想使用自己的自定义图标,您可以将它们上传到 Squarespace,然后使用“插入图像”按钮将它们添加到您的文本中。

Font Awesome 是一种用于向 Squarespace 网站添加图标的著名工具,可用于执行此操作。 图标将占用您页面上的少量空间,因此仅将它们添加到绝对必要的地方。 Font Awesome Icons 页面使更改每个图标的外观变得简单。 还有一些内置类可用于为图标设置动画。 假设您想将整个页面设为红色:。 可以通过转到“设计”将以下代码添加到页面。

您可以在 Squarespace 中添加图标吗?

您可以使用图标库将图标添加到 Squarespace。 此部分包含一些您可以在您的网站上使用的图标。 要将库中的图标添加到站点,只需单击它,然后单击“添加到站点”。 您将能够使用此命令将图标添加到您的站点。

Svg转PNG

您可能想要将 SVG 文件转换为 PNG 的原因有几个。 也许您想为您的网站创建一个徽标,并且您需要一个高分辨率的 PNG 才能在您的网站上使用。 或者,也许您正在 Illustrator 中进行设计,您需要将其转换为 PNG 以用于模型。 不管是什么原因,有几种方法可以将 SVG 转换为 PNG。
如果您可以访问 Adob​​e Illustrator,则只需在程序中打开 SVG 文件并将其导出为 PNG。 如果您没有 Illustrator,可以使用一些免费的在线工具来帮助您转换文件。 只需搜索“SVG 到 PNG 转换器”,您就会找到几个选项。

图形和徽标可以从使用 SVG 文件中获益。 由于图像更清晰、更小,它们加载速度更快,在您的网站上占用的空间更少,这是一个很大的优势。 此外,当在完全或部分透明的背景上查看时,您的图形将显得非常出色。
将 SVG 文件用于徽标和图形是个不错的主意。 您可以使用它们来创建图形和网站设计。